| dc.description.abstract | The article is a thought piece that challenges the wide held belief that manufacturing has moved out of South Australia since the demise of the automotive industry. It presents some examples of local industry and their manufacturing success and points to the future where defence will be driving manufacturing in the state. an article in a book "INNOVATE Adelaide" - p74ISBN - 978-1-949677-66-9 | |
